Print Bubir 2 is a regular weight, normal width, low contrast, reverse italic, normal x-height font.

A casual hand-drawn print with rounded, monoline strokes and softly irregular contours. Letters show gentle rightward lean and loose, variable proportions that create an organic rhythm. Terminals are blunt and slightly tapered, bowls are open and circular, and curves dominate over strict geometry. Spacing feels airy and forgiving, with small, intentional inconsistencies that reinforce the handwritten texture while remaining readable.

Best suited to contexts that benefit from an informal, human voice—children’s materials, playful branding accents, craft and DIY packaging, greeting cards, and upbeat posters or social graphics. It works particularly well for short-to-medium copy, headings, captions, and quotes where the handwritten character can be appreciated.

The overall tone is warm, approachable, and lightly goofy—more like a quick marker note than a formal type specimen. Its uneven rhythm and soft shapes give it a personable, kid-friendly energy that reads as relaxed and conversational.

The design appears intended to simulate quick, friendly hand lettering with consistent stroke weight and a relaxed slant, prioritizing approachability over typographic precision. Its controlled irregularity suggests a goal of keeping text readable while preserving the spontaneity and charm of drawn letters.

Uppercase forms are simple and rounded, avoiding sharp joins, while lowercase keeps a single-storey, handwritten logic with prominent ascenders and descenders. Numerals match the same informal construction, with friendly, rounded figures that blend naturally into text. The sample text shows comfortable legibility at larger sizes, where the subtle wobble becomes a key part of the charm.
